site stats

Clickhouse uuid主键

WebMar 17, 2024 · 数据表设计之主键自增、UUID或联合主键; Java之for循环内外创建对象的区别; Java之基本数据类型和包装数据类型; 代码规范之注释该怎么写; 代码格式之什么样的代码格式才是正确的; Java之时间处理(当前年的上一年、上一季度、当月、当季) Nginx代理之大 … Web此示例演示如何在表中创建UUID类型的列,并对其写入数据。. CREATE TABLE t_uuid (x UUID) ENGINE=TinyLog. INSERT INTO t_uuid SELECT generateUUIDv4() SELECT * FROM t_uuid. ┌────────────────────────────────────x─┐. │ f4bf890f-f9dc-4332-ad5c ...

clickhouse 建表 主键_作文_星云百科资讯

http://geekdaxue.co/read/x7h66@oha08u/rtoacx WebUUID 是一种数据库常见的主键类型,在 ClickHouse 中直接把它作为一种数据类型。 UUID 共有 32 位,它的格式为 8-4-4-4-12。 如果一个 UUID 类型的字段在写入数据的时候没有被赋值,那么它会按照相应格式用 0 填充。 dr. swapna dhillon psychiatry https://ptjobsglobal.com

clickhouse的主键和索引分析 - 渐逝的星光 - 博客园

WebSep 16, 2024 · 2024年ClickHouse最王炸功能来袭,性能轻松提升40倍. 各位,今年 ClickHouse 最王炸的功能来啦,没错,就是期待已久的 Projection (投影) 功能。. ClickHouse 现在的功能已经非常丰富强大了,但是社区用现实告诉我们,还可以进一步做的更好:). 那么通常过滤查询 Where A ... WebApr 25, 2024 · 1.2.3、UUID. UUID 是一种数据库常见的主键类型,在 ClickHouse 中直接把它作为一种数据类型。UUID 共有 32 位,它的格式为00000000-0000-0000-0000 … WebMar 1, 2024 · Memory引擎是ClickHouse最简单的表引擎,数据只会被保存在内存中,在服务重启时数据会丢失。 4、Clickhouse的数据类型, 在创建数据表的时候指定字段的数据类型, 数据类型在使用的时候是区分大小写的 ,所以在定义字段的时候一定注意数据类型的书 … dr swanson orthopedic jacksonville

重构某网API服务 Blog

Category:How to insert a DF into a clickhouse table, if data type is uuid …

Tags:Clickhouse uuid主键

Clickhouse uuid主键

篇一 ClickHouse快速入门 - 知乎

Web上文提到MergeTree表引擎无法对相同主键的数据进行去重,ClickHouse提供了ReplacingMergeTree引擎,可以针对相同主键的数据进行去重,它能够在合并分区时删除重复的数据。值得注意的是,ReplacingMergeTree只是在一定程度上解决了数据重复问题,但是并不能完全保障数据 ... WebApr 12, 2024 · 拓展一:通过配置文件配置主键生成策略. mybatis-plus: global-config: db-config: id-type: auto # assign_id、assign_uuid、input、none; 拓展二:雪花算法. 简介:雪花算法是由Twitter公布的分布式主键生成算法,它能够保证不同表的主键的不重复性,以及相同表的 主键的有序性

Clickhouse uuid主键

Did you know?

Webvalue — 键值对的value,类型可以是: String, Integer, Array, LowCardinality, 或者 FixedString. 使用 a ['key'] 可以从 a Map ('key', 'value') 类型的列中获取到对应的值,这是一个线性复杂度的查询。. 如果在 Map () 类型的列中,查询的 key 值不存在,那么根据 value 的类型,查询结果 ... WebClickHouse的索引深入了解. . 一、一级索引. 在MergeTree中PRIMARY KEY 主键并不用于去重,而是用于索引,加快查询速度,MergeTree会根据index_granularity间隔(默认8192行),为数据表生成一级索引并保存至primary.idx文件内,索引数据按照PRIMARY KEY 排序,相对于使用PRIMARY KEY 更常见的方式是通过ORDER BY 方式指定主键。

WebDec 5, 2024 · ClickHouse是Yandex开源的高性能的列式分析数据库。关于性能测试,可以看看这两篇: 官方Benchmark; Mark Litwintschik的压测文章. 这篇文章,其实是对ClickHouse的开发者Alexey Milovidov,在Google … Web上图不难理解,我们把AccountId作为我们的主键字段,Clickhouse每间隔8192行数据会取一次AccountId作为索引值,索引数据最终被写入primary.idx文件进行保存。 如上的编号0、编号1、编号2是按照字段顺序紧密排序在一起的,比如1112345689,因此我们可以看出MergeTree对于 ...

WebJul 12, 2024 · 2.3 UUID. UUID经常会在数据库中使用,有时候还会作为主键,ClickHouse直接将UUID作为了一种数据类型。UUID一共有32位,格式为8-4-4-4-12,如果UUID类型的字段在写入数据时没有被赋值,则会按照格式用0来填充。ClickHouse还提供了generateUUIDv4来生成随机的UUID。 WebApr 13, 2024 · SummingMergeTree引擎继承自MergeTree。区别在于,当合并SummingMergeTree表的数据片段时,ClickHouse会把所有具有相同主键的行合并为一行,该行包含了被合并的行中具有数值数据类型的列的汇总值。如果主键的组合方式使得单个键值对应于大量的行,则可以显著的减少存储空间并加快数据查询的速度。

WebMar 6, 2024 · ClickHouse 的索引优化. 1.分区,原则是尽量把经常一起用到的数据放到相同区(也可以根据where条件来分区),如果一个区太大再放到多个区,. 2.主键(索引,即排序)order by字段选择: 就是把where 里面肯定有的字段加到里面,where 中一定有的字段放 …

WebWe discussed that because a ClickHouse table's row data is stored on disk ordered by primary key column(s), having a very high cardinality column (like a UUID column) in a primary key or in a compound primary key before columns with lower cardinality is detrimental for the compression ratio of other table columns. color testing photoWebClickHouse 按主键对数据进行排序,一致性越高,压缩效果越好。. 在CollapsingMergeTree 和 SummingMergeTree 引擎中合并数据部分时提供额外的逻辑。. 在这种情况下,指定不同于主键的排序键是有意义的。. 1)长主键会对插入性能和内存消耗产生负面影响,但主键中 … dr swapna roy fullertonWebClickHouse的索引深入了解. . 一、一级索引. 在MergeTree中PRIMARY KEY 主键并不用于去重,而是用于索引,加快查询速度,MergeTree会根据index_granularity间隔(默 … color test gold blue green orangeWebMar 9, 2024 · 如果在插入新记录时未指定UUID列值,则UUID值将用零填充: 00000000-0000-0000-0000-000000000000; 如何生成. 要生成UUID值,ClickHouse提供了 generateuidv4 功能。 用法示例. 示例1. 此示例演示如何创建具有UUID类型列的表并将值插入到表中。 CREATE TABLE t_uuid (x UUID, y String) ENGINE = TinyLog dr swan vance thompsonWebClickHouse提供索引和数据存储的复杂机制,能够实现在高负载下仍有优异的读写性能。当创建MergeTree表时需要选择主键,主键影响大多数查询性能。本文介绍主键的工作原 … dr. swapna mishra fortisWeb对主键来说,要保证在所有分片中都唯一,它本质上就是一个全局唯一的索引。 如果用大部分同学喜欢的自增作为主键,就会发现存在很大的问题。 因为自增并不能在插入前就获得值,而是要通过填 NULL 值,然后再通过函数 last_insert_id()获得自增的值。 color test for workWebWhat Is ClickHouse? ClickHouse® is a high-performance, column-oriented SQL database management system (DBMS) for online analytical processing (OLAP). It is available as both an open-source software and a cloud offering. dr swan traverse city